Output e1c98af647c2ba3e9da2d5ba714ccbf57804dcf70b3c603ecacdd9d0dd5f1a85:2

value
107106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b855169cc0a98cb07aca7a014da15064e5716e OP_EQUAL
address
3NMoTY1ZW6QMN95Hd71TFdPYPzeqq7XWCz
transaction
e1c98af647c2ba3e9da2d5ba714ccbf57804dcf70b3c603ecacdd9d0dd5f1a85
confirmations
154794
spent
true